STMicroelectronics LD1085D2T15R Voltage Regulator
The LD1085D2T15R is a high-performance, low-dropout voltage regulator from STMicroelectronics, designed to deliver a stable and precise 1.5V output voltage. This regulator is part of the LD1085 series, which is well-suited for a variety of sensitive electronic applications requiring a consistent power supply.
With its ability to handle a maximum current of up to 3A, the LD1085D2T15R is an ideal choice for high-current applications. It boasts a low dropout voltage of just 1.3V at a full load, which ensures efficient operation even when the input voltage is close to the output voltage, minimizing power loss and heat generation.
The device is housed in a TO-263 (D2PAK) package, which provides a compact footprint while allowing for adequate heat dissipation. This makes the LD1085D2T15R suitable for space-constrained applications while maintaining a high level of performance.
One of the key features of the LD1085D2T15R is its adjustable output voltage, which can be set from 1.25V to a maximum of 13.8V with the use of external resistors. This flexibility allows designers to tailor the output voltage to specific needs, making the device highly versatile across different applications.
The regulator also includes several protective features to ensure the longevity and reliability of both the LD1085D2T15R and the devices it powers. These include overcurrent protection, thermal shutdown, and SOA (Safe Operating Area) control, which together provide a robust defense against a range of potential issues.
